Question About Foul Plugs.
Well...Today I was driving and all the sudden, the car died. I pulled over at a seven eleven and I cant figure out what is giong on. I check the IC piping, the Bipes connections, looks for oil, didnt find nothing. well eventually, ten minutes later, i found that the Pipe off the Throttle Body poped off. Well before I figured this out, i was reving the car and what not, and saw black smoke ( thank god it wasnt white ) So, then I found the culprit and tightened it up. Now it missed fired. I drove it home and found One foul plug. I know Plan on getting some new NGK's Tommorrow. I have a few questions
1. Is .030 a good gap for turbo'd car plugs?
2. Missfiring, does it run on one less cylinder or does the foul plug fire, but not as strong?
3. Do I just buy regular NGKS (Iradium/Platnum) and gap them, Or is there a specific "colder" plug that I need to buy?
I didnt even know there was cold plugs and hot plugs.
